bitzz Posted July 5, 2022 Share Posted July 5, 2022 Chain sizes are easy to figure out The first number is the pitch, the distance from pin to pin in 1/8"... so a 520 or 530 chain is 5/8" pitch, a 630 is 3/4" pitch and a 428 is 1/2" pitch The next two numbers is the sprocket thickness... a 530 is 3/8", 520 is 1/4, a 525 is 5/16 ... but nothing governs the OUTSIDE dimensions... a 530 chain could be 1 1/8" wide (outside) for a cheapo Oring or as narrow as 0.8" for a DID HD Non Oring. Modern 520 chains can be as strong as 630 chains of 1980. If I am changing chains I usually use a 520.
